Detecting hidden plumbing leaks
Early discovery of leaking water lines can reduce a possible catastrophe. In addition to saving you cash, it will lessen the stress and disappointment. The moment you find a leakage, calling your plumber for repairs is the most effective solution. Nevertheless, some small water leakages might not show up. If you can not discover it with your nude eyes, right here are some hacks that aid.

1. Examine the Water Meter



Every residence has a water meter. Inspecting it is a guaranteed manner in which aids you uncover leakages. For beginners, switch off all the water resources. Guarantee no one will certainly flush, use the faucet, shower, run the washing machine or dish washer. From there, go to the meter as well as watch if it will certainly change. Since no one is using it, there should be no movements. If it moves, that indicates a fast-moving leakage. If you detect no adjustments, wait an hour or 2 as well as check back once more. This implies you might have a sluggish leak that might even be underground.

2. Inspect Water Usage



Assess your water bills as well as track your water consumption. As the one paying it, you must see if there are any type of inconsistencies. If you identify sudden changes, regardless of your consumption being the same, it indicates that you have leaks in your plumbing system. Keep in mind, your water costs need to drop under the same range monthly. An abrupt spike in your costs shows a fast-moving leak.

At the same time, a stable increase monthly, even with the same behaviors, reveals you have a slow-moving leak that's likewise gradually intensifying. Call a plumber to thoroughly examine your building, specifically if you feel a warm location on your flooring with piping beneath.

4. Asses Outside Lines



Do not forget to examine your exterior water lines too. Needs to water seep out of the connection, you have a loosened rubber gasket. One little leak can lose loads of water as well as increase your water bill.

5. Evaluate the circumstance and check



Property owners ought to make it a routine to examine under the sink counters and also inside closets for any kind of bad odor or mold growth. These two warnings indicate a leak so timely focus is needed. Doing regular inspections, even bi-annually, can save you from a significant problem.

Examine for stainings as well as deteriorating as most devices as well as pipelines have a life expectations. If you presume dripping water lines in your plumbing system, do not wait for it to rise.

Signs You Have a Hidden Plumbing Leak


Damaged floors, walls, or ceilings


Water-damaged floors, walls, and ceilings are often warped, sagging, drooping, or covered in stains. You might also notice that the paint is chipping off of your walls due to water coming into contact with and separating the paint from the wall surface.




Extra-green patches of grass


Because pipes are often underground, it is not uncommon for a leak to affect your lawn. If you find that a certain area of your grass is growing faster than other areas of your lawn, there might just be an underground leak.




Higher-than-usual water bills


If your water bill is much too high each month, and it doesn’t seem to match up with your actual water usage, something is definitely up with your system.


Continuously running meter


Your water meter should not be running all of the time. If you turn off all running water in your home and your water meter still shows that water is running, there is a leak somewhere in your system.
